How to create procedural building generation mods that maintain architectural logic and interior usability.
This guide explores designing procedural building generation mods that uphold plausible architecture while preserving interior usability, balancing creative randomness with structural integrity, and ensuring players experience coherent, navigable interiors within dynamic environments.
July 15, 2025
Facebook X Reddit
Procedural building systems sit at the intersection of design rigor and creative exploration. When you build an architecture-friendly mod, your first priority is establishing a robust rule set that governs how rooms, corridors, doors, and stairs connect. The engine should consistently enforce constraints that prevent impossible layouts, such as overlapping rooms, inaccessible corners, or misaligned doorways. Start by drafting a modular grid of rooms that can scale up or down without breaking coherence. Define standard room templates, corridor widths, and standard heights, then encode relationships so that adding a room never disrupts existing flow. This foundation pays dividends when you want to generate varied neighborhoods while keeping a believable structural logic throughout.
After you lock in architectural rules, you must translate them into procedural logic that the game can execute efficiently. Use deterministic seeds to guarantee repeatable layouts while still allowing randomness for exploration. Implement a zoning system that designates residential, commercial, or industrial blocks with appropriate constraints. Each zone should have its own interior heuristics—corridor placement, window density, and lighting patterns—that respect local proportions. Build a lattice of constraints that prevents doors from opening into walls and ensures sufficient clearance around furniture. Efficient data structures, such as graphs for connectivity and grids for placement, help maintain performance as complexity grows. Testing across varied seed values reveals edge cases and guides refinement.
Iteration and testing across diverse environments sharpen reliability.
A successful procedural builder feels believable because it adheres to architectural logic while still offering surprise. The trick is to separate global rules from local variation. Global rules govern overall height limits, maximum floor counts, and the general arrangement of zones. Local variation handles room shapes, furniture placement, and decorative details. By decoupling these layers, you can enjoy fresh configurations without sacrificing interior usability. Include guard rails like minimum doorway widths and reach ranges for controls to ensure that every generated interior remains navigable. Integrate fallbacks for unusual combinations to avoid dead ends that disrupt gameplay. With careful layering, each new layout remains coherent and comfortable to navigate.
ADVERTISEMENT
ADVERTISEMENT
Interior usability hinges on predictable yet flexible layouts. Design modules that guarantee clear sightlines to key areas, logical traffic flow, and adequate lighting. For example, ensure kitchens adjacent to dining spaces with unobstructed access to circulation corridors. Bathrooms should be strategically placed near bedrooms and living areas without creating awkward detours. As you assemble rooms procedurally, simulate typical human movement patterns to confirm that routes feel natural. Include heuristic checks that enforce standard furniture footprints, so sofas and tables don’t block windows or doors. When a layout passes connectivity tests and usability checks, it’s ready for players to explore without feeling trapped or disoriented.
Clear logic and interior comfort fuel lasting player engagement.
Procedural generation excels when you can iterate quickly, testing new ideas in varied contexts. Build a test harness that runs hundreds of layout generations under different seeds, scales, and zone distributions. Collect metrics on accessibility, path length, and room count to quantify usability. Use visualization tools to inspect generated maps—color-code zones, highlight misplaced elements, and reveal connectivity gaps. Establish a feedback loop that ties empirical data to rule adjustments. When you notice frequent bottlenecks, adjust constraints such as minimum corridor widths or door spacing. This systematic approach accelerates refinement and helps you strike a balance between variety and usability.
ADVERTISEMENT
ADVERTISEMENT
Extend usability by designing adaptive interiors that respond to player actions. Allow certain spaces to reconfigure themselves when a player merges rooms or adds new volumes. For example, when a storage area expands, automatically reallocate nearby shelves and lighting to maintain a coherent reading of space. Implement responsive furniture templates that maintain proportional scale regardless of room size. You can also empower players with optional presets that emphasize different moods—cozy, industrial, minimalist—while preserving operation logic. The goal is a living environment that feels intelligent, not chaotic, as players sculpt their own spaces through procedural edits.
Practical tools and community support reinforce sustainable modding.
Achieving a seamless blend of logic and comfort takes disciplined data architecture. Build a central map of architectural rules that governs every generation step. This spine should articulate how rooms connect, where stairs lead, and how daylight enters interiors. Layer rule sets so that zone-specific constraints override general ones when appropriate, enabling distinct character per neighborhood. Maintain an extensible catalog of furniture radii, door types, and window placements so new content remains compatible. With a well-structured rule hierarchy, you can introduce new architectural styles or era-specific elements without compromising existing layouts. The result is a mod that evolves gracefully rather than collapsing under complexity.
Documentation and tooling empower creators and users alike. Provide clear, readable guides that explain constraints, seeds, and customization options. Include in-engine wizards for generating sample layouts, plus debug views that show rule evaluations in real time. Offer presets that demonstrate how architectural logic translates into livable interiors, helping players learn by example. When users see the logic in action, they gain confidence to experiment without fear of breaking usability. Equally important is a community hub where players share seeds, annotated layouts, and tips for achieving specific architectural vibes within the procedural framework.
ADVERTISEMENT
ADVERTISEMENT
Long-term viability depends on thoughtful evolution and community input.
A practical modding workflow centers on versioned releases and backward compatibility. Keep a changelog that documents rule adjustments, new templates, and performance optimizations. Provide migration paths for existing maps when interior rules shift, preventing abrupt incompatibilities. Performance matters: optimize pathfinding and generation steps by pruning redundant calculations and caching results where possible. Profile memory usage and frame-time impact across different map sizes, ensuring the mod remains usable on a range of hardware. Consider optional low-detail modes for consoles or lower-end rigs. When players can rely on consistent performance, they’re more likely to adopt and advocate for your procedural system.
Accessibility options broaden who can enjoy procedural builds. Include adjustable control schemes for navigation, scalable UI, and colorblind-friendly palettes for zoning and furniture. Implement keyboard, mouse, and controller support harmoniously, so players can interact with the generator in comfortable ways. Provide tooltips that explain why certain decisions were made by the generator, demystifying the process and reducing confusion. A thoughtful accessibility approach expands your audience and invites broader experimentation with interior configurations, which in turn fuels more meaningful feedback.
Beyond initial release, plan a roadmap for updates that extend architectural variety. Introduce new architectural vernacular—colonial, modern, brutalist, or vernacular craftsman—each with its own rule set and interior heuristics. Maintain compatibility by isolating style-specific logic so it can be toggled on or off without disrupting existing layouts. Encourage user-generated content by providing templates, example seeds, and a simple modding interface that lowers the barrier to entry. Community-driven iterations often reveal practical improvements not evident in isolated development environments, aligning your project with real player needs and preferences.
Finally, cultivate a culture of rigorous quality assurance. Establish clear acceptance criteria for layout validity, interior usability, and performance thresholds. Run automated checks that detect obvious rule violations and broken connectivity, then review edge cases flagged by players. A transparent beta program helps you gather diverse perspectives and catch issues early. When the mod consistently delivers believable, navigable interiors across a spectrum of environments, it earns trust and longevity. With consistent polish, your procedural building system becomes a staple tool for creators seeking immersive, architecturally sound worlds.
Related Articles
A practical guide that explores design patterns, storytelling context, and usability testing to make crafting interfaces feel natural, responsive, and self-evident, while preserving game balance and player progression.
August 05, 2025
In dynamic game economies, adaptive balancing algorithms shape player choices by interpreting behavior signals, scarcity levels, and expanded production chains from mods, ensuring a responsive, fair, and engaging experience across varied playstyles and communities.
August 12, 2025
Creatively designed game modifications can foster dynamic, player driven social systems that evolve over time, shaping reputations, spreading rumors, and elevating fame as players interact within crafted environments.
August 09, 2025
Adapting cinematic cutscenes into mods demands balancing pacing, preserving voice acting integrity, and maintaining immersion; this guide outlines timeless practices for creators to keep cinematic intent intact amid customization.
July 30, 2025
A clear blueprint outlines layered spaces, player roles, and monetization mechanics, guiding designers to craft enduring museum experiences within mods that invite collaboration, curation, and sustainable engagement.
August 09, 2025
A practical guide to designing recurring events in game mods that captivate players daily, sustain interest weekly, and celebrate milestones without causing burnout or diminishing long-term enjoyment.
July 21, 2025
Crafting roguelike mods that sustain long-term progression while delivering fresh runs requires thoughtful design, adaptive scaling, meaningful choices, and careful pacing to maintain challenge without eroding core progression rewards.
August 11, 2025
A practical, evergreen guide outlining modular visual regression testing strategies for texture and shader changes, focusing on repeatable pipelines, robust image comparisons, and scalable testing architectures across game environments.
August 10, 2025
This evergreen guide explores layered discovery frameworks, balancing quality signals, compatibility checks, and personal relevance to help players find mods they will actually enjoy and trust.
July 16, 2025
Designing modular multiplayer systems for mods demands scalable instances, flexible shard rules, and seamless integration with shared hubs to support both private sessions and communal exploration.
August 06, 2025
Crafting resource gathering mods that encourage exploration while preserving scarcity requires careful tuning, clear progression incentives, adaptive pacing, and robust testing to avoid over-farming while maintaining player curiosity and long-term engagement.
August 08, 2025
Thoughtful mod release processes blend rigorous testing, clean packaging, and proactive community rollout to sustain long-term quality, transparency, and engagement across diverse platforms, players, and modding communities.
July 16, 2025
In modding, transforming single-use assets into modular, reusable components enables faster iteration, easier collaboration, and scalable content pipelines that adapt to evolving game engines and player expectations.
August 12, 2025
A thoughtful approach to summoning and pet mechanics that respects player choices, maintains strategic depth, and sustains fluid, dynamic combat without overwhelming players or diminishing core gameplay.
July 21, 2025
Crafting progression systems should ease players into mechanics, reveal options progressively, and balance freedom with guided goals, ensuring a satisfying, nonintimidating experience that scales with player proficiency and curiosity.
July 23, 2025
This evergreen guide explores practical strategies for animating idle NPCs with personality, covering procedural motion, micro-interactions, rhythm, and adaptive responses to environment, players, and events.
July 19, 2025
This evergreen guide explains designing modular city services in mods where players must finance, recruit staff, and upgrade infrastructure, balancing economics, gameplay tension, and long-term city resilience through thoughtful systems.
August 09, 2025
A practical, evergreen guide to crafting immersive museum and archive mods, balancing lore, artifacts, and community voices, while ensuring accessibility, sustainability, and compelling narrative flows across gameplay environments.
July 28, 2025
This evergreen guide explains how layered AI personalities can dynamically alter NPC behavior, choices, and loyalties, offering practical frameworks for modders seeking richer, more responsive worlds with scalable complexity and engaging player encounters.
July 23, 2025
Crafting living, responsive relationships among NPCs requires systems thinking, careful dialogue design, and dynamic consequence tracking that reflects a player's choices over time.
July 18, 2025